Gwinnett Brewery is a location in the Commonwealth.
Background[]
This venerable brewing operation was started by a local beer maker named Button Gwinnett, namesake of one of the founding fathers. Their Southie Stout was voted "Boston's Best Beer of 2051 and 2062."[1]

When the Great War struck survivors would stumble into the restaurant. A few weeks later and the looters would attack the building for any and all supplies, the survivors then fled into the paired facility. Melissa locking herself in the closet of the restaurant and a male survivor barred himself in the rooftop computer room.[7] Currently, the brewing factory is a dilapidated home for mirelurks.
Layout[]
The entrance is partitioned from the main factory floor by an Expert-locked door (which can also be opened with the Advanced-locked terminal). Down the first catwalk, there is a hole in the southwestern wall that contains a pipe leading to The Gwinnett Restaurant.
The rest of the main factory floor is a flooded mess, with collapsed catwalks throughout. Therefore, to navigate the room, one must go to the southeastern wall and across the pipe heading southwest. The pipe leads over a catwalk that one can drop down to, which leads to the brewing systems office.
More pipes outside the office lead southeast to another catwalk that grants access to the rooftop. There are two separate pods on the roof: one barred from the inside, one locked (Advanced). The bar inside can be shot through the broken window, allowing access to another brewing system terminal
Notable loot[]
- An edition of Tales of a Junktown Jerky Vendor is found in the upper floor office, beside the brewing systems terminal.
- The Gwinnett Stout recipe holotape is obtained by ejecting it from the brewing system on the roof.
- A Nuka-Cola Quantum is found behind the sheet of plywood beside the Nuka-Cola machine at the entrance.
